Which part of your knob has split FF? The chrome part I am pretty sure is metal judging by how cold it gets, and the usual problem is that the chrome scratches and comes away. The core of the knob is plastic and this does split, which is what happened to my previous one.

You just missed a chrome/black leather one in VGC in the stock exchange.

Plenty of people swear by the Storm Motorworks knobs - these are heavier and reputedly improve the gearchange.
